The laboratory grinder LWM 100 is the ideal machine in the field of crushing with a narrow particle size distribution. Products with a hardness of up to 4 Mohs can be crushed to the required final product in a narrow preselectable particle size spectrum. By means of freely selectable settings the dust content can be minimised. The laboratory grinder LWM 100 is suitable for use in pilot plants or for small-scale production.
Use in the Pilot Plant
With the laboratory grinder LWM 100 it is possible to examine which operating data yield the desired crushing results.
By means of simple roller exchange the optimum roller corrugation is determined. The following parameters can be determined:
- The influence of the differential roller speed on the product
- The maximum possible circumferential speed referred to the respective product
- The behaviour of the product in the roller gap and on the rollers can be observed
- A simulation of several grinds with different rollers is possible
- Rapid and uncomplicated adjustment of the grinding gap
